Carbets de la BO: AOTs go from 3 to 5 years

0

This was a point of dissatisfaction: the operators of Eastern Bay carbets will finally have a Temporary Occupation Authorization (AOT) extended by 2 years.

This decision was taken Tuesday during the meeting at the initiative of the prefect Anne Laubies between the collective "Saint-Martin Wake Up" and the Collectivity, in the prefecture. President Aline Hanson and Vice-President Wendel Cocks have thus agreed to extend the duration of the AOT for operators of the AW34 plot from 3 to 5 years. Deliberation will be taken shortly by the Executive Council. This meeting allowed to raise all the grievances related to carbets. The Collectivity is notably committed to cleaning the access road between Galion and Orient Bay, to collect sargassum and to verify the safety measures concerning the gas installation of the kitchens. The other claims, this time of a general nature, will be addressed at a future meeting.
